What is Personal Data?
Personal data is data related to a living individual who can be identified from that data. This can also include special categories of personal data (personal data revealing racial or ethnic origin, political opinions, religious or philosophical beliefs, trade union membership, and genetic data, biometric data, health data and data concerning a person’s sex life or sexual orientation) and personal data relating to criminal convictions and offenses.

YOUR RIGHTS

If you wish to see a copy of the personal data we hold about you then you can ask us at any time and we will respond within the time periods laid down in local data protection laws.

Under certain circumstances, you also have the right to:

·       Request correction of the personal information that we hold about you.

·       Request erasure of your personal information. This enables you to ask us to delete or remove personal information where there is no good reason for us continuing to process it.

·       Object to processing of your personal information where we are relying on a legitimate interest (or those of a third party) and there is something about your particular situation which makes you want to object to processing on this ground.

·       Request the restriction of processing of your personal information. This enables you to ask us to suspend the processing of personal information about you, for example if you want us to establish its accuracy or the reason for processing it.

·      Request the transfer of your personal information to another party.

Where we process your personal information because we have your consent to do so you may withdraw your consent at any time.

You can make a request in relation to any of the rights set out here by contacting the relevant Body Hub company and using the contact details for the relevant country set out in the “Who is responsible for the processing of your personal data?” section above.  Alternatively, you can contact us using the details set out in the “Contacting us” section below.

If you wish to make a complaint about how we are processing your personal information you have the right to make a complaint at any time to the local data protection authority. You can find out how to contact the ICO on their website, www.ico.org.uk).
